N. Maraşlı is a scholar working on Materials Chemistry, Mechanical Engineering and Aerospace Engineering. According to data from OpenAlex, N. Maraşlı has authored 134 papers receiving a total of 2.6k indexed citations (citations by other indexed papers that have themselves been cited), including 111 papers in Materials Chemistry, 78 papers in Mechanical Engineering and 77 papers in Aerospace Engineering. Recurrent topics in N. Maraşlı’s work include Solidification and crystal growth phenomena (83 papers), Aluminum Alloy Microstructure Properties (77 papers) and Electronic Packaging and Soldering Technologies (32 papers). N. Maraşlı is often cited by papers focused on Solidification and crystal growth phenomena (83 papers), Aluminum Alloy Microstructure Properties (77 papers) and Electronic Packaging and Soldering Technologies (32 papers). N. Maraşlı collaborates with scholars based in Türkiye, United Kingdom and South Korea. N. Maraşlı's co-authors include U. Böyük, K. Keşli̇oǧlu, E. Çadırlı, Sezen Aksöz, Hasan Kaya, Y. Ocak, J.D. Hunt, Mehmet Gündüz, Sevda Engin and Mustafa Erol and has published in prestigious journals such as Journal of Applied Physics, Acta Materialia and Journal of Colloid and Interface Science.
